CC -!- FUNCTION: Part of the energy-coupling factor (ECF) transporter complex
CC CbiMNOQ involved in cobalt import. {ECO:0000256|HAMAP-Rule:MF_01462}.
CC -!- PATHWAY: Cofactor biosynthesis; adenosylcobalamin biosynthesis.
CC {ECO:0000256|HAMAP-Rule:MF_01462}.
CC -!- SUBUNIT: Forms an energy-coupling factor (ECF) transporter complex
CC composed of an ATP-binding protein (A component, CbiO), a transmembrane
CC protein (T component, CbiQ) and 2 possible substrate-capture proteins
CC (S components, CbiM and CbiN) of unknown stoichimetry.
CC {ECO:0000256|HAMAP-Rule:MF_01462}.
CC -!- SUBCELLULAR LOCATION: Cell inner membrane {ECO:0000256|HAMAP-
CC Rule:MF_01462}; Multi-pass membrane protein {ECO:0000256|HAMAP-
CC Rule:MF_01462}. Membrane {ECO:0000256|ARBA:ARBA00004141}; Multi-pass
CC membrane protein {ECO:0000256|ARBA:ARBA00004141}.
CC -!- SIMILARITY: Belongs to the CbiM family. {ECO:0000256|HAMAP-
CC Rule:MF_01462}.
